負載均衡策略 Linux系統NGINX負載均衡404錯誤處理方法?
Linux系統NGINX負載均衡404錯誤處理方法?Nginx load balancing 404 error handling method使用Nginx實現負載均衡,但是一組服務器的數據不同步,
Linux系統NGINX負載均衡404錯誤處理方法?
Nginx load balancing 404 error handling method
使用Nginx實現負載均衡,但是一組服務器的數據不同步,當主服務器有數據時,它需要一些時間來同步到其他服務器
上游圖片.stream.com{
服務器192.168.1.25:8088
服務器192.168.1.24:8088
服務器192.168.1.23:8088
}
當用戶訪問圖片時,有60%的用戶如何配置以下功能:
1。當您連接到圖像服務器時,如果瀏覽機器沒有24或23上的圖像服務器,您將默認選擇另一個25?解決方案:proxyuunextuuupstream error timeout invaliduuheader httpu500 httpu503 httpu404
這個問題有點外行。。。
Nginx作為一個負載平衡服務組件,以其近乎絕對的穩(wěn)定性、優(yōu)異的性能等特點,已經成為企業(yè)應用中不可或缺的平衡工具
!可以看出nginx是一個提供外部負載平衡的服務組件??梢蕴峁┑呢撦d平衡策略包括但不限于以下內容:
1,輪詢:每個應用程序服務器平均接收請求。
默認模式:只要通過服務器配置了多個應用服務器,就可以默認執(zhí)行輪詢
!2、重量:根據一定的重量,為不同的機器分配不同的訪問號碼。
通過weight=4語句結構進行配置
!3、ip_uuhash:通過ip進行哈希訪問服務器分配,可以解決輪詢會話不在一臺機器上的問題
使用ip_uuhashon
!4、公平:根據應用服務的響應時間動態(tài)分配服務器。